Overview

Bacterial and fungal enteropathogens and their toxins encompass a broad spectrum of infectious agents and their secreted virulence factors that cause gastrointestinal disease (NIH, 2023). This group includes bacteria like Vibrio cholerae and Clostridium difficile, as well as fungi such as Candida species, which disrupt intestinal homeostasis through invasion or toxin production (StatPearls, 2024). Toxins, such as the Shiga toxin or C. difficile Toxin B, act by inhibiting protein synthesis or disrupting the host cell cytoskeleton, respectively (PubMed, 2021). Therapeutic intervention typically targets the pathogens themselves using antibiotics or antifungals, or targets the toxins using neutralizing monoclonal antibodies like bezlotoxumab (FDA, 2016). Because this entry refers to a collection of organisms and molecules rather than a single receptor or enzyme, it is not considered a discrete molecular target in drug discovery (PubChem, 2024). Instead, it represents a therapeutic area focused on treating enteric infections and toxemia.
